Output 1aec29e7698079dfb93fc46fa475b315726339263b29d363a8d22fb59ec7da80:1

value
143832
script pubkey
OP_0 OP_PUSHBYTES_20 7951c4fac9c2bc6729a3d8f11c326a7991428151
address
bc1q09guf7kfc27xw2drmrc3cvn20xg59q23h92m57
transaction
1aec29e7698079dfb93fc46fa475b315726339263b29d363a8d22fb59ec7da80
confirmations
188074
spent
true